  • (rewire)

  • rewire

    English

    Verb

    (rewir)
  • To replace or reconnect the wires of a device or installation.
  • :I had to rewire the circuit where the old wires had shorted out.
  • :The electrician said that we couldn't add a new outlet without rewiring .
  • To change the functionality of something by altering the parameters or logic.
  • :When our companies merged, I rewired our payment processing system to handle their invoices as well.
